π Foodify-Android-App - Enjoy Delicious Food Anytime!
π Getting Started
Welcome to Foodify, a complete Android food delivery application. This app allows you to browse restaurants, manage your cart, and enjoy a smooth ordering experience, much like Swiggy or Zomato. Whether youβre at home or on the go, Foodify makes food delivery simple and efficient.
π₯ Download Foodify

To get started with Foodify, visit the Releases page to download the application. Follow the steps below to install and run the app on your Android device.
β¬οΈ Download & Install
- Visit the Releases page.
- Look for the latest version of Foodify.
- Download the APK file by clicking on it.
- Once the download finishes, locate the file on your device.
- Tap the APK file to start the installation.
- If prompted, allow installations from unknown sources in your device settings.
- Follow the on-screen instructions to complete the installation.
π± Requirements
- Android Version: Requires Android 5.0 (Lollipop) or higher.
- Storage Space: Requires at least 100 MB of free storage.
- Internet Connection: A stable internet connection is necessary for the app to function smoothly.
π¨ Features
- Restaurant Browsing: Easily browse through a wide range of restaurants in your area.
- Cart Management: Add, update, or remove items in your cart with a simple tap.
- Maps Integration: See restaurant locations and track your order on the map.
- User-Friendly Interface: Enjoy a modern, intuitive design that enhances your experience.
- Seamless Ordering: Place your order in just a few steps with easy payment options.
π Technologies Used
Foodify utilizes several technologies to ensure a solid performance and an enjoyable user experience:
- Java: The main programming language for the app.
- MVVM Architecture: This design pattern helps separate the user interface from the business logic.
- Room Database: Manages local data storage for a smoother experience.
- Retrofit: Simplifies API calls to fetch restaurant data.
- Material Design: Provides a modern and responsive design.
π€ Contributing
Foodify welcomes contributions from everyone! If you would like to help improve this app, please follow these steps:
- Fork the repository.
- Create your feature branch (git checkout -b feature/YourFeature).
- Commit your changes (git commit -m βAdd some featureβ).
- Push to the branch (git push origin feature/YourFeature).
- Open a pull request.
π Issues
If you encounter any bugs or have suggestions for new features, please report them on the Issues page. Your feedback helps us improve the app.
π FAQ
1. How do I update Foodify?
To update, simply go to the Releases page and download the latest version. Install it over your existing version.
2. Can I uninstall Foodify?
Yes, you can uninstall Foodify like any other application. Go to your settings, find the app, and select βUninstall.β
3. What if I face issues during installation?
Make sure you have allowed installations from unknown sources in your settings. If you continue to face problems, please check the Issues page for solutions.
π Support
For any support inquiries, please open an issue on GitHub, and we will get back to you as soon as possible.
Thank you for choosing Foodify! We hope you enjoy your meals.